MPP says 10 doors are closing, close to 500 jobs eliminated
10 offices of the Workplace Safety and Insurance Board, known as WSIB, will be closing, including the one in St. Catharines.
St. Catharines NDP MPP Jennie Stevens releasing the news yesterday, adding the organization is cutting almost 500 jobs.
She says this means the loss of local jobs, and, importantly, the loss of experienced people who handle Ontario's workers' compensation system.
She questions Premier Doug Ford's recent announcement of 119,000 more jobs in Ontario, to these job losses.
She adds this means longer claims processing time, and delays for people needing the money to live.
